首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我如何优化这个替换列和索引的代码?

要优化替换列和索引的代码,可以考虑以下几个方面:

  1. 数据库设计优化:确保表结构设计合理,字段类型选择适当,避免冗余数据和不必要的索引。可以使用数据库设计工具进行建模和优化。
  2. 索引优化:根据查询需求和数据访问模式,选择合适的索引类型(如B树索引、哈希索引等),并确保索引覆盖所需的查询条件。可以使用数据库性能分析工具(如Explain)来分析查询执行计划,优化索引的创建和使用。
  3. 查询优化:避免全表扫描和大量的数据操作,尽量使用索引来加速查询。可以通过优化查询语句、使用合适的连接方式(如内连接、外连接等)、合理设置查询条件等方式来提高查询效率。
  4. 批量操作优化:对于大量数据的替换和索引操作,可以考虑使用批量操作(如批量插入、批量更新)来减少数据库的访问次数,提高性能。
  5. 编程语言优化:根据具体的编程语言和框架,可以使用一些优化技巧来提高代码执行效率,如使用缓存、异步操作、并发处理等。
  6. 定期维护和优化:定期进行数据库性能监控和优化,包括索引重建、数据清理、统计信息更新等操作,以保持数据库的高性能运行。

对于替换列和索引的具体代码优化,需要根据具体的业务场景和代码实现来进行分析和优化。以上是一些常见的优化方向,具体的优化策略需要根据实际情况进行调整和实施。

关于腾讯云相关产品和产品介绍链接地址,可以参考腾讯云官方文档和官方网站,了解他们提供的数据库、存储、云原生等相关产品和解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券